虚拟机(Virtual Machine, VM)技术作为云计算的核心组成部分,通过模拟物理硬件环境,为应用程序提供了隔离的运行空间,极大地提升了资源利用率和系统灵活性
然而,随着虚拟机数量的激增,如何有效管理这些虚拟实例,确保它们的安全运行与高效运维,成为了企业面临的一大挑战
在此背景下,虚拟机管理账户(VM Management Account)的角色显得尤为关键,它不仅是企业云环境的守护者,更是推动资源优化与业务连续性的重要力量
一、虚拟机管理账户的定义与重要性 虚拟机管理账户,简而言之,是指专门用于管理、监控、配置及优化虚拟机集群的权限账户
这个账户通常拥有高级别的访问权限,能够执行包括创建/删除虚拟机、分配资源、安装软件、执行安全更新、监控性能以及故障排除等一系列操作
其重要性体现在以下几个方面: 1.安全管理:通过集中管理虚拟机账户,企业可以实施统一的安全策略,如强制密码策略、多因素认证等,有效防止未授权访问和数据泄露
同时,定期审计和监控账户活动,能够及时发现并响应潜在的安全威胁
2.资源优化:虚拟机管理账户允许管理员根据业务需求动态调整资源配置,如CPU、内存和存储,确保资源得到合理分配和利用,避免资源浪费,降低成本
3.高效运维:集中的账户管理简化了虚拟机生命周期管理,从部署、维护到退役,整个过程更加自动化和高效
此外,通过集成监控工具,管理员可以快速定位并解决性能瓶颈,保障业务连续性
4.合规性保障:在高度监管的行业,如金融、医疗等,虚拟机管理账户能够帮助企业遵守相关法律法规和行业标准,通过细致的权限划分和审计日志记录,确保所有操作可追溯、合规
二、虚拟机管理账户的最佳实践 为了确保虚拟机管理账户的有效性和安全性,企业应遵循以下最佳实践: 1.最小权限原则:为每个管理任务分配最小必要权限,避免过度授权
例如,仅允许特定人员拥有创建或删除虚拟机的权限,而其他人员可能仅需要监控权限
这有助于减少因权限滥用导致的安全风险
2.角色基础访问控制(RBAC):实施RBAC策略,根据角色而非个人分配权限
这不仅可以简化权限管理,还能确保当人员变动时,权限调整更加迅速和准确
3.定期审计与监控:建立定期审计机制,检查账户活动日志,识别异常行为
同时,利用先进的监控工具实时监控虚拟机性能和安全状态,及时预警潜在问题
4.自动化与编排:采用虚拟机管理软件和自动化工具,如VMware vSphere、Microsoft Hyper-V或开源的Kubernetes等,实现虚拟机部署、配置和管理的自动化
这不仅能提高效率,还能减少人为错误
5.安全培训与意识提升:定期对虚拟机管理员进行安全培训,提高他们对最新安全威胁的认识和应对能力
同时,建立安全意识文化,鼓励所有员工参与维护云环境的安全
6.应急响应计划:制定详尽的应急响应计划,包括虚拟机被入侵、数据丢失等情况下的处理流程
定期进行模拟演练,确保在真实事件发生时能够迅速、有效地响应
三、面临的挑战与应对策略 尽管虚拟机管理账户在提升云环境管理方面发挥着关键作用,但在实际应用中也面临一些挑战: - 复杂性与规模性:随着虚拟机数量的增加,管理复杂性也随之上升
应对策略包括采用更先进的自动化工具和智能分析技术,以简化管理流程并提升效率
- 安全与合规性的平衡:如何在提供足够灵活性的同时确保安全与合规,是一个持续的挑战
企业应定期评估安全策略的有效性,并根据最新的威胁情报进行调整
- 技能缺口:虚拟机管理要求管理员具备较高的技术水平和专业知识
企业应投资于员工培训,同时考虑引入外部专家资源,以提升整体运维能力
四、未来展望 随着云计算技术的不断演进,虚拟机管理账户的角色将更加多元化和智能化
例如,通过人工智能和机器学习技术,未来的虚拟机管理系统将能够预测资源需求、自动优化配置,并主动识别潜在的安全风险
此外,随着容器化和微服务架构的普及,虚拟机管理账户将需要与容器编排系统(如Kubernetes)无缝集成,以支持更广泛的工作负载管理
总之,虚拟机管理账户是企业云环境中不可或缺的一环,它不仅是保障系统安全、提升资源利用率的基石,更是推动业务创新与发展的关键驱动力
通过实施最佳实践、应对挑战并展望未来,企业能够更好地驾驭虚拟机技术,为数字化转型之路奠定坚实的基础